Maintaining financial stability fosters a more secure and predictable environment for both consumers and investors. When financial systems are stable, individuals feel more confident in engaging with financial markets, leading to heightened consumer trust. This trust is crucial for the functioning of the economy, as it encourages people to invest, borrow, and spend, thereby facilitating economic growth. A trustworthy financial environment assures consumers that their investments are safe, and that institutions are sound and reliable, further reinforcing their willingness to participate in the market.
